What is QualifyAI?

QualifyAI is an AI-powered intake and lead evaluation tool built directly into Lawmatics. It helps firms automatically evaluate every new lead, prioritize high-value prospects, and take action faster using consistent, firm-defined rules.

QualifyAI provides transparent reasoning for every evaluation, and can trigger automations based on lead outcomes.

With QualifyAI, firms can:

  • Identify which leads to chase, refer out, or review further as soon as they arrive.

  • Apply the same evaluation criteria to every prospect, reducing human bias and inconsistency.

  • Automatically trigger follow-ups, assignments, and notifications based on lead quality.

Over time, QualifyAI becomes more accurate as firms provide feedback and refine criteria, helping teams focus on the right cases faster and more consistently.


How QualifyAI Works

At a high level, QualifyAI follows a simple lifecycle:

  1. You define your firm’s intake rules using a Lead Qualification Agent

  2. QualifyAI evaluates leads using those rules

  3. You review results and provide feedback when outcomes aren’t what you expect

  4. You have QualifyAI refine the evaluation criteria based on that feedback

  5. These valuation results appear across Lawmatics and can trigger automations

This approach allows firms to continuously improve lead evaluation accuracy while saving time on manual intake review without losing control over how leads are scored.


What Is a Lead Qualification Agent?

A Lead Qualification Agent is an AI that evaluates incoming leads based on your firm's own intake rules. Each agent represents the evaluation logic for a specific practice area.

Best practice:
Create one agent per major practice area so each area can use its own categories, criteria, and scoring logic.

Each agent includes:

  • Categories – How leads are classified, such as Chase Hard, Chase, Refer Out, Reject, or Inconclusive

  • Criteria – The rules that the Agent uses to evaluate leads

  • Versions – Tracked updates created as criteria are refined over time


Categories, Criteria, and Scores

Understanding these core concepts will help you interpret your Lead Scores:

Categories

Categories represent the outcome for a lead. For example, a category may indicate whether a lead should be prioritized for immediate follow-up (Chase Hard,) referred to another firm (Refer Out,) or reviewed further (Inconclusive.)

Criteria

Criteria are the specific rules the Agent uses to evaluate leads. These may include factors such as case type, jurisdiction, potential case value, urgency, or other client details.

Criteria can be:

  • Proposed automatically by QualifyAI based on best practices for the practice area.

  • Proposed automatically by QualifyAI based on existing firm information.

  • Reviewed and adjusted by the firm, as needed.

Confidence and Reasoning

For every evaluation, QualifyAI provides:

  • A Confidence Score, indicating how strongly the lead matches your criteria

  • Confidence Reasoning, showing which factors influenced the result

This transparency allows firms to understand each recommendation and identify where criteria may need refinement.


Training QualifyAI Over Time

Firms can:

  • Compare expected outcomes with predicted results

  • Review reasoning when evaluations don’t match expectations

  • Provide feedback explaining why a result was correct or incorrect

Based on this feedback, QualifyAI can propose refinements to the agent’s criteria. Saving these updates creates a new agent version, allowing firms to track improvements over time and compare results across versions.

How QualifyAI Drives Action with Automations

QualifyAI evaluations can be used as an action in automations and to trigger automations within Lawmatics.

For example, when a lead is categorized as Chase Hard with high confidence, an automation can send an E-Signature Request and assign a follow-up task to your team:

This allows firms to engage high-priority prospects immediately, without waiting for manual review.
